The model has brought many practical benefits. Thanks to the local force, people are guided closely and easily, thereby reducing the digital gap between age groups and regions. The CNSCĐ team helps people register and use online public services, improving the service efficiency of local authorities. At the same time, small businesses and traders are supported with electronic payments, opening trading floors, promoting products, contributing to the development of the digital economy from the grassroots.
In addition, access to and experience with technology and digital platforms helps people form the habit of using technology and participating in the digital society. The model also supports the implementation of strategic goals such as the rate of people with digital skills, the rate of participation in digital services, etc. The CNSCD team is both an implementation factor and a practical feedback channel for management agencies.
In many provinces and cities, the CNSCĐ Teams are acting as a bridge between the government and the people, helping to disseminate knowledge and support people to use online public services effectively. The CNSCĐ Team model has been widely deployed in provinces and cities across the country.
According to statistics up to September 2024, the whole country has established about 93,524 CNSCĐ Teams with nearly 457,820 members. In Tuyen Quang province, the whole province has 1,733 Digital Technology Teams in villages and residential groups; along with 138 Digital Technology Teams at the commune level, with a total of over 10,000 members. In Dak Lak province, by the end of June 2025, 2,065 CNSCĐ Teams with 12,572 members had been established. The above figures show that the CNSCĐ Team model has not only been established in many localities but also been perfected at the grassroots level (villages, residential groups, residential areas), this is an important step to bring digital transformation to people and households.
Maintaining the regular operation of the groups, especially in rural and remote areas, still requires regular support in terms of training and equipment.
Digital skills are not just about installing applications but also understanding and using them effectively, avoiding the situation of "only knowing how to install but not exploiting".
Quantitative statistics are needed to evaluate effectiveness: number of supported households, increased rate of digital service usage, impact on digital economy, etc.
Connecting and interconnecting the national/local digital platform with the people is also a key factor. It is necessary to expand the model not only to the people but also to small traders, business households and micro-enterprises, thereby creating a digital value chain from the grassroots, contributing to promoting comprehensive digital transformation.
